    A few tips for you deady, store you’re water drum on top of the exhaust catwalk all day, then You will have warm water to have a wash on an evening, also keep an open bottle of water in the footwell it will keep moisture in the air and stop the night heater drying your mouth out while you sleep 👍🏻

    I have meet bloke driving car transporter who was 23. He started with a ridgid from age of 19. I am 21 and doing my licence, so it's possible but, believe me its not a job for someone reckless (young). I have done driving as a job for past year but it wasn't lorries so I am bit anxious and other most important thing is insurance and experience. 1. Most companies won't insure you until you are 25. Experience is hard to gain as it's harder to find a job due to young age, you take whatever job is given to you and gain experience before you can look for something better. Like some some other chap advised you, look for other profession until mid 20s.

    Best of luck to you mate, I am 21 soon and in exactly the same position as you. I had a absolutely fun job but things turned bad when I nearly beat the crap of bullying supervisor. I wanted to do the licence for class 1 or 2 anyways and if not for me quiting my job I would probably delay that for too long. If you enjoy driving then this job will be great for you. If I can give you advice look for trunking jobs, refrigerator units are good, usually short distances between depos or 3-4 hrs one way and back. I know people who work 9-11 hrs tops a day and they get bloody good money for that. (it takes time to find such a job, but it's possible ). Entire qualification for Class 1 including class c exams medicals etc would cost you £2400-£2700. (loan in my case) Depending where you find your course. 3month in one go and you could have class 1.
